Output 5e651fe7df573e473dbc16436caf61e30433d1262b5c2f80438476b1f7b1dae8:6

value
58758686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4393d1e34423676e0e2c8268d7d4fd3f78ef3113 OP_EQUAL
address
ME4UazEzF3itEjU4JT9Vb9b1wDNBdV5ZfQ
transaction
5e651fe7df573e473dbc16436caf61e30433d1262b5c2f80438476b1f7b1dae8
spent
true